How this role transforms workplaces:

  • Acts as point of contact for Human Resources and serves as the liaison between the client and Xenium.
  • Acts as a resource for employees in all different aspects of HR.
  • Works collaboratively with Xenium payroll provider to deliver accurate and on time payroll which includes troubleshooting, entry of hours, maintenance and auditing.
  • In conjunction with the Senior HR Business Partner, provides Human Resource guidance and compliance to client.
  • Responds to HR questions from managers and employees as well as providing disciplinary and coaching support. Utilizes Xenium team for assistance/guidance with technical and strategic HR issues.
  • Collaborates with hiring managers to manage the end-to-end recruitment process, ensuring compliance with company policies and procedures.
  • Conducts qualitative reviews of resumes and applications to identify top candidates that meet the requirements of the position.
  • Utilizes applicant tracking systems to manage candidate workflow and maintains accurate recruitment records.
  • Coordinates and facilitates hiring panel kick-off meetings and selection meetings, ensuring alignment with hiring objectives and timelines.
  • Develops and maintains relationships with external recruitment agencies and other talent sourcing partners to support recruitment efforts.
  • Provides guidance and support to hiring managers on best practices for candidate evaluation and selection.
  • Assists in the development of job descriptions and job advertisements to attract qualified candidates.
  • Stays current with recruiting trends and best practices to continually improve recruitment processes and outcomes.
  • Schedules and conducts new hire and benefits orientations and if applicable, delivers follow up paperwork to Xenium and carriers.
  • Works with the Xenium team to administer benefit plans and is the employee point of contact for benefit inquiries. 
  • Works with managers to ensure that all the proper documentation is in place for all aspects of HR.
  • Participates in employee counseling and termination meetings as appropriate; coordinates all aspects of terminations in conjunction with the Xenium team.
  • Works with the Xenium team in implementing HR project deliverables to include: Employee Handbooks, Job Descriptions, Wage Surveys, HR Audits, Employee Satisfaction Surveys, Performance Management Programs, Trainings and other client company objectives.
  • Manages performance review process to include filing and tracking of review forms. Reviews incoming performance reviews for completeness. 
  • Works with the Xenium team to produce appropriate leave paperwork and assists with leave tracking.
  • Administers the workers’ compensation process.
  • Participates in the client meetings to discuss HR related assigned topics as needed.
  • Attends relevant seminars and training workshops to keep abreast of HR best practices as well as employment law updates.
  • Maintains the personnel filing system to include applicants, active and inactive employees.
  • Assists the Xenium team with responding to unemployment claims and participates in hearings when needed.
  • Drives and completes miscellaneous HR projects as assigned.
